So all of the online shopping I told you about last week arrived!!  My Gap order included these mules, this bikini top and this gingham top from Old Navy which are all keepers (yay!).  From American Eagle I'm keeping this top, but sending back the bikini bottoms and this top as it was way too short and boxy :(.  The bikini bottoms I actually liked but I'm trying to find a pair that doesn't cut into my sides too much (hello, muffin top!) and these definitely did.  I went on a mad online search for bikini bottoms after those ones didn't work out but finally decided to just wait until closer to summer when (hopefully) my muffin top has shrunk and I'm feeling more confident about trying on bikini bottoms in general.  I have a couple of pairs that mix and match with a bunch of tops right now that fit fine, and a couple of one-pieces so I'm covered for now.  And how adorable is that Gap top?!  It's so adorable, I can't wait to wear it!  Normally I would have ordered an XS, but they were sold out so I ordered a Small and it fits fine ... so just an FYI if you are planning on getting it!  The mules I ordered in a size 7; my typical size is 6.5 and they fit great with a tiny bit of room at the heel, so I'm not sure if the 6 would have been too small.  The gingham top from Old Navy I ordered in XS and the fit is slightly oversized.  I find Old Navy typically fits on the larger size so I always order the smallest size!

Unfortunately the romper and pleated midi skirt from H&M are returns, and I haven't decided if the mules are slightly too big or fine.  The pleated midi was a size too small and the poly material looked and felt cheap.  The romper was really cute and I wanted to love it, but I didn't think it was that flattering and I didn't like the slits down the arms.  Plus, where am I going to wear that?!  I'd rather hold out for a jumpsuit (or something else) that I really LOVE.  The mules feel a bit big, but they are sold out online now so I can't try on the smaller size for comparison ... what should I do?!  They're just a plain kind of beige mule, not that special, but super versatile for Spring I feel!  They would replace the beige flats I'm wearing with the pleated midi skirt above, which are overdue for retirement!  Lastly, (but not leastly), this striped top from Hollister arrived and is a keeper.  It fits oversized and is so soft!  I ordered my usual size (XS) and it has a nice, relaxed vibe to it.
